import multihash, threading, time
class Hashthread(threading.Thread):
def __init__(self, filelist, hashlist, algorithms, *args, **kwargs):
self.filelist = filelist
self.hashlist = hashlist
self.algorithms = algorithms
threading.Thread.__init__(self, *args, **kwargs)
def run(self):
try:
while 1:
f = self.filelist.pop(0)
h = multihash.hash_file(f, self.algorithms)
self.hashlist.append((f, h))
except IndexError:
return
def hash_files(files, num_threads = 1, algorithms = ('ed2k',)):
hashlist = []
threads = []
for x in xrange(num_threads):
thread = Hashthread(files, hashlist, algorithms)
thread.start()
threads.append(thread)
while hashlist or sum([thread.isAlive() for thread in threads]):
try:
yield hashlist.pop(0)
except IndexError:
time.sleep(0.1)
raise StopIteration
